MILWAUKEE AREA PATIO & ROOFTOP DINING GUIDE

Enjoy the food and fresh air!

Warmer weather has finally arrived, and it’s time to soak it all in! If you’re searching for the best rooftop and patio dining spots to enjoy the season, this guide is for you. From kid-friendly hangouts to perfect picks for a Mom’s Night Out or Date Night, we’ve rounded up the top spots to savor great food and sunshine—whether you’re with the family or taking a well-deserved break.

Boone and Crocket

Located on the Milwaukee River, the patio overlooks the Hoan Bridge and is a great way to take in a Milwaukee night. Check out the Light the Hoan light schedule and take in the show while you dine. Taco Moto truck is on-site, you can order online ahead of time, and I cannot recommend the nachos enough. *Chef’s Kiss*

818 S Water St, Milwaukee

Pizza Man

The original Pizza Man burned down in a tragic fire in 2010. Rebuilt and better than ever, their East Side venue has an incredible rooftop dining! They also feature a vast collection of wine on tap. Live music on Wednesdays and 1/2 off bottles of wine!

2060 N Humboldt Blvd., Milwaukee
11500 W. Burleigh St., Wauwatosa
